Pool Pavers Installation in Norwalk, CT
Pool pavers installation involves selecting and laying durable, attractive paving materials around a pool area to enhance safety, functionality, and aesthetic appeal.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ating non-slip surfaces for pool decks, designing walkways, and surrounding pools with custom patterns or finishes. Homeowners often seek pool paver installations to improve their outdoor space’s appearance, ensure safe footing, and increase property value, making it essential to consider factors such as material choice, layout design, and drainage before requesting a project.
Property owners typically want to understand the different types of pavers available, such as concrete, stone, or brick, and how each performs in a poolside environment. It’s also important to consider the installation process, including surface preparation and durability, as well as maintenance requirements. Clarifying these details can help ensure the selected design aligns with the property's style, budget, and long-term use, providing a functional and visually appealing pool area.

Common Pool Pavers Installation Jobs
Pool deck paving - creates a durable and slip-resistant surface around swimming pools.
Custom pool paver designs - enhances the aesthetic appeal of backyard swimming areas.
Pool area renovations - updates existing paver installations for improved safety and style.
Poolside walkways - provides safe and attractive pathways connecting pool features.
Pool coping installation - finishes the edge of the pool with a polished, functional border.
Drainage and slope adjustments - ensures proper water runoff to prevent pooling and erosion.
Pool Pavers Installation Questions
What are pool pavers? Pool pavers are durable, decorative stones or tiles designed to surround and enhance swimming pool areas, providing a safe and attractive surface.
Which materials are commonly used for pool p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, natural stone, and porcelain, each offering different styles and durability levels.
Can pool pavers be installed on existing surfaces? Yes, pool pavers can be installed over existing concrete or other flat surfaces with proper preparation to ensure stability.
What should property owners consider before installing pool pavers? It is important to consider the climate, drainage, and the desired aesthetic to select the most suitable paver type and design for the space.
